.employer_section { width: 999px; background-color: #FFFFFF; margin:0 auto; padding-top:12px }
.employer_content { width:969px; margin:auto }

#login_employer div.left { background: url(/images2009/bg_login_employer_l.jpg) no-repeat; float:left; width:239px; height:132px }
#login_employer div.middle { background: url(/images2009/bg_login_employer_m.gif) repeat-x; float:left; width:210px; height:112px; padding:10px 12px 10px 23px }
#login_employer div.right { background: url(/images2009/bg_login_employer_r.gif) no-repeat; float:left; width:445px; height:112px; padding:10px 20px }
#login_employer div.title { width:104px; height:13px; background: url(/images2009/title_login_employer.gif) no-repeat; overflow:hidden }
#login_employer h1 { font-size:1px; margin:0; padding:0; visibility:hidden }

.login_hspace { height:8px; font-size: 1px; overflow:hidden; clear:both }
.login_description { color:#FFFFFF; width:210px; margin:10px 0 7px 0 }
.login_label { float:left; color:#FFFFFF; font-size:88%; width:55px }
.login_input, { float:left; width:144px }
.login_forgetpassword { float:left; margin-top:10px; width:103px }
.login_forgetpassword a { color:#FFFFFF; font-size:88%; text-decoration: underline }
.login_loginbutton { float:left ; margin-top:5px; width:86px }

.login_contact_title { float:left; width:18% }
.login_contact_description { float:left; width:82% }
.login_contact_hspace { clear:both; height:1px; line-height:1; font-size:1px; margin:0; padding:0; overflow:hidden }

.login_explain_title { float:left; color:#A04D6E; width:25% }
.login_explain_description { float:left; width:75% }
.login_explain_hspace { clear:both; height:8px; line-height:8px; font-size:1px; margin:0; padding:0; overflow:hidden }